| In Marienbad the 14th International Psychoanalytical Congress is held, at which Jacques Lacan presents a paper on the mirror stage. | |
| On his 80th birthday congratulations arrive from a multitude of international scientists, writers and artists. The well-wishers include James Joyce, Pablo Picasso, Leonard and Virginia Woolf, H.G. Wells, Albert Schweitzer, Albert Einstein and many others. | |
| Freud dedicates an article to Romain Rolland on his 70th birthday: A Disturbance of Memory upon the Acropolis. | |
